HOW WE DO IT
·
Prepare cost analysis based on the architectural
drawings, engineering estimates, materials required and labour involved.
·
Prepare cost plans to enable design teams to
produce practical designs for construction projects, which involve liaising
with architects, engineers and subcontractors.
·
Prepare tender and contract documents, including
bills of quantities
·
Evaluate tenders from contractors and
subcontractors and, where appropriate, negotiate with the contractors.
·
Control all stages of projects within
predetermined budget and expenditure.
·
Monitor and keep track of project progress and
are responsible for the measurement and valuation of variations in the work
during the contract, for agreement of interim payments and the final account.
·
Work as part of a team to ensure that the
requirements of the client are delivered.
·
Carry out monthly valuations of work in
progress, including forecasting of final costs
·
Provide advice to project staff on commercial
and contractual matters including reviewing and drafting of correspondence.
·
Commercial vetting of sub-contractor tenders and
contracts.
·
Certification of subcontractor monthly
valuations and final accounts.
·
Communicate regularly with project staff and
specialist subcontractors to ensure commercial controls are in place,
understood and followed at all times.
·
Manage and produce accurate formal reports in
accordance with business timetable.
